The bright and shining soul of Patricia “Pat” Fowler, age 67, of Marshalltown, Iowa, left her earthly home and entered into the gates of Heaven on Sunday evening, June 18, 2023. She passed at Mary Greeley Medical Center in Ames a brief battle with cancer.
Family, faith and education were Pat’s core values and she wore them on her sleeve. Born Patricia Ann White on October 25, 1955 in Marshalltown, Iowa, she was the daughter of Edward Joseph and Mary Marcella “Sally” (Fitzpatrick) White. After meeting the love of her life, Randy Fowler, they were united in marriage on June 16, 1984 at St. Mary Catholic Church. The couple was blessed with two beautiful daughters and have shared a wonderful life together, filled with laughter and love.
Pat’s faith radiated to all those around her. A devout member of St. Francis Parish: St. Mary Catholic Church, she also served on the Parish Council and was a part of the women’s bible study. She made a point of saying the Rosary every single day. Pat taught her family to live by faith and the importance of giving back to the community. She volunteered at Iowa River Hospice and on the Riverside Cemetery Board.
Education was also incredibly important to Pat. After her graduation from Marshalltown High School in 1973, she obtained her Bachelor’s Degree at the University of Northern Iowa. She then graduated with her Master’s Degree in Education from Drake University in Des Moines. Pat enriched the lives of hundreds of children over 32 years in the Marshalltown School District, where she taught 8th grade mathematics.
In her free time, Pat enjoyed listening to music, attending Irish concerts, and playing with her dogs. She was so great at staying connected with people, spending hours every day on the phone with different family members. Pat always put others first and made sure that everyone else was happy. Even near the end, she asked her loved ones not to worry about her. She was kind, selfless and compassionate and she will be deeply missed by all those who knew her.
